IndiGo anchors the non-stop service on Lucknow–Ahmedabad, generally with a couple of direct flights a day, and Akasa Air and Air India add further options, some direct and some connecting. On a typical day you have around two to three non-stops to choose from, plus several one-stop itineraries via a hub for off-peak times.
Carriers that no longer fly should not appear on your search: Go First and Jet Airways have ceased operations, and Vistara has merged into Air India. Compare IndiGo, Akasa and Air India before booking, as the cheapest and best-timed option shifts by date.
Lucknow to Ahmedabad is about 1,050 km, flown non-stop in roughly 1h 50m. The route runs west-south-west across north and central India into Gujarat. Both cities are on Indian Standard Time, so there is no clock adjustment.
A one-stop via Delhi or Mumbai adds a couple of hours and is worth considering only when the timing or price clearly beats the direct flight. For most travellers the non-stop is the obvious choice on a sector of this length.
This route carries business, trade (Lucknow–Gujarat commercial links are strong) and visiting-family traffic. Demand climbs around festivals — notably Navratri in Gujarat, when Ahmedabad fills up — and during the winter wedding season. Lucknow: Chaudhary Charan Singh International Airport (LKO) now operates from the modern integrated Terminal 3, opened in 2024, which handles both domestic and international flights. It is spacious and well-signed.
Ahmedabad: Sardar Vallabhbhai Patel International Airport (AMD) has two terminals. Low-cost domestic flights (IndiGo, Akasa, Air India Express) use Terminal 1, while Air India moved all its Ahmedabad operations to Terminal 2 from 29 March 2026. Check which carrier you are flying so you arrive at the correct terminal — the two are separate buildings.
At Lucknow (LKO): the airport at Amausi is about 15 km south-west of the city centre. App cabs and pre-paid taxis are the usual options; allow 30–45 minutes depending on traffic.
At Ahmedabad (AMD): the airport is roughly 10 km north-east of the city centre — relatively close. App cabs, pre-paid taxis and the BRTS/AMTS bus network serve it; the run into the centre typically takes 25–40 minutes. If you fly Air India, head to Terminal 2; for IndiGo, Akasa or Air India Express, Terminal 1.

Lucknow sits on the north Indian plains and can see dense winter fog (December–January) that delays early-morning departures — build a buffer if you have an onward connection from Ahmedabad. Both cities are hot in summer (April–June); Gujarat's monsoon (June–September) brings spells of heavy rain that can cause short delays. Yes. Under DGCA rules airlines may charge a cancellation fee but must refund the balance, including taxes and user development fees, within prescribed timelines. Cancellation within 24 hours of booking is usually free if travel is at least 7 days away.
